At St Vincent, May 16. West Indies won by six wickets. Toss: South Africa.
Cuffy's ten economical overs off the reel, bringing him three for 24, helped West Indies to a consolation victory in his first international appearance on his home island. In spite of Kallis's fighting 69, sharp catching and keen ground fielding restricted South Africa to 163 for seven, their third-lowest completed one-day total against West Indies. The loss of Lara and Hooper, both caught by Gibbs at short extra cover off Kemp, caused some flutterings, but Samuels and Chanderpaul put on 62 to see their team home, delighting a crowd that swelled beyond its 8,000 capacity during the day. The winning run came off Rhodes, bowling for the first time in one-day internationals on his 200th appearance (a South African record). Pollock received the Cable & Wireless "Bowled Over" Trophy for his team and the Man of the Series award for himself, rewarding his all-round performances in both Tests and one-day internationals.
Man of the Match: C. E. Cuffy.
Man of the Series (Tests and one-day internationals): S. M. Pollock.
